- Did you mean
- elt0057 ex e 20 pmpc
- elt0083 ex e 20 pucb
- Related search terms
- elt0057 elr e 20 po
- elt0057 em e 20 pipe
- elt0057 em e 20 park
- elt0057 em e 20 pad
- elt0057 em e 20 pres
-
ITM Engine ComponentsITM Engine Components 15-00537 Engine Oil pump O ring